In today’s modern world, avoiding stress is virtually impossible. Everyone struggles with the pressures of work, a social life, and trying to find the balance between money, work, family, friends, and personal time. However, stress causes more problems than you can imagine, such as headaches, loss of libido, stomach problems, teeth grinding, anger, irritability, lack of energy, and even depression.

If you are looking for ways to reduce your stress levels without going to the gym, keep reading for some of the most creative ways to de-stress and take control of your life.

1. Go Outside – Try eating your lunch outside, or walking your dog after work. Even stepping outside for just 5 minutes and taking some deep breaths can help relieve stress.

2. Read one chapter in a fascinating book.

3. Take a power nap, no more than 20 minutes.

4. Get a massage.

5. Peel an orange or a lemon. The smell of citrus reduces stressful feelings.

6. Hang out and vent with your BFF.

7. If you can, bring your dog to work.

8. Listen to relaxing music.

9. Try aroma therapy, it really works!

10. Find a way to get 5 minutes worth of belly laughs. Not just your average ‘lol,’ but the kind of laughter that makes your belly ache.

11. Enjoy an avocado.

12. Take 10 power breaths by inhaling for 4 seconds, and then imagine releasing your stressful feelings when you exhale for the following 6 seconds. Repeat 10 times.

13. Sing! In your car, at karaoke night, or in the church choir.

14. Call your sister, your mom, your dad, anyone!

15. Unsubscribe from all those promotional emails.

16. Try some mindful meditation

17. Have sex more often.

18. Try hugging at least 3 people every day.

19. Kiss your cat and/or dog. Feel the love!

20. Take up knitting, crocheting, or needlepoint.
